No! These bags are usually designed to hold a ton of building material such as sand or gravel. Also called "dumpy bags" or "bulk bags", the most common size can hold about 0.7 cubic metres of logs which, being less dense than sand or gravel, will weigh considerably less than a ton. Total Materials Required for 1m3, Cement - 8 bags, Sand - 14.83 Cft, Aggregate - 29.66 Cft, Therefore, We need the volume of concrete for 5.4m3, Cement = 5.4 x 8 ( 8 bag of cement for 1m3) = 43.2 - 43 bags, Sand = 5.4 x 14.83 (14.83 cft of sand for 1m3) = 80.08 cft, Aggregate = 5.4 x 29.66 (29.66 cft of aggregate for 1m3) = 160.164 cft,

Density of Sand = 1450 - 1500 kg/ m3, Density of Aggregate = 1450 - 1550 kg/ m3, Quantity or Weight of Cement in 1 Bag = 50 KG, Volume of 1 Bag Cement in Cum = 0.03472 cubic meter, Volume of 1 Bag Cement in Cft = 1.226 cubic feet, Numbers of Cement Bags in 1 cum = 28.8 nos. wet packed sand has a density of 2.08 kg/L which is 2080 kg/m or 2.08 tonne/m . packed mud has a density of 1.91 kg/L which is 1910 kg/m or 1.91 tonne/m . cubic meters of sand * 2.08 tonne/m = tonnes of sand. cubic meters of mud * 1.91 tonne/m = tonnes of mud. Weight per meter of different dia of steel bar. 6 = 0.222 kg per meter. 8 = 0.395 kg per meter. 10 = 0.617 kg per meter. 12 = 0.888 kg per meter. 16 = 1.58 kg per meter. 20 = 2.469 kg per meter. With help of this formula, you can find any type of dia bar weight. (d2 ÷ 162)

As a quick answer, a concrete mix ratio of 1 part cement, 2 parts fine aggregate (sand) and 4 parts course aggregate will cover most general domestic jobs. Concrete mixed at this ratio is generally known as a C20 mix and it's more than suitable for garden paths, concreting fence posts, shallow retaining wall foundations, some extension bases ...

M25 concrete mix ratio is 1:1:2, made of mixture of cement, sand and aggregate in which one part is cement, 1 part is sand and 2 part is aggregate or stone mix with water. 1m3 m25 concrete weight : unit weight of RCC is 2500kg/m3 and PCC is 2400kg/m3, so weight of 1m3 M25 concrete is 2500kgs when used as reinforced cement concrete and 2400kgs ...

The cement you are adding has no effect to the volume as the grains of cement are so small they fit in the gaps left by the larger grains of sand. So, 1m3 of sand + 15 bags of cement = 0.9m3 of screed. Strange but true. Â, Oct 3, 2006. #6.

1m 3 of cement = 1440 kgs. 0.28m 3 of cement = 1440 x 0.28 = 403.2 kgs. For 1m 3 of Concrete = 403.2Kgs of Cement will be necessary. No. of Cement Bags necessary for 1m3 of Concrete = 403/50 = 8.06 ~ 8 bags. Therefore, 8 bags of cement is necessary for 1m3 of concrete. 1 cubic meter of sand weighs 1200-1700 kg on average - 1500 kg. Gravel and crushed stone. According to various sources, the weight of 1 cubic meter ranges from 1200 to 2500 kg depending on the fraction (size). Heavier - more than fine. 1 : 3 : 3 MIX RATIO. To produce a 3000 psi cubic yard of concrete (27 cubic feet) the concrete mixture ratio is: 517 pounds of cement or (234kg) 1560 pounds of sand or (707kg) 1600 pounds of stone or (725kg) 32 - 34 gallons of water or (132L) This mixing ratio will give you a concrete mix that is strong, durable, and good for most concrete ...

Density of sand average 1400-1600 kg/M3 Loose sand density =1442 kg/M3 Dry sand =1600 kg/M3 Packed sand =1682 kg/M3 Wet sand =2082 kg/m3 Use of 1600 kg/M3 Convert 1600/1000= 1.6 tonnes Thank you Site engineer (civil) Herbert Levinson Former Retired Maintenance Tech Author has 225 answers and 70.5K answer views 2 y

Multiply the length by the width by the depth of the topsoil. Multiply the number of cubic metres by 1.7 tonnes to find out how much topsoil you need. If it's 4 cubic metres, that would be 6.8 tonnes (14,991lb). Select an online conversion calculator to determine cubic metres. Enter the width in metres of the area of topsoil.
